Subject: Telemetry compression — ownership change

Hi all, and welcome to the team. As of this sprint, responsibility for the telemetry payload compression pipeline in Skylark has moved off the platform group. This covers the codec selection, batching thresholds, and the decompression service. Please direct design questions, incident escalations, and review requests to the new owner, named below.

named custodian: Brivan Eliath Quenox Frador

## v3.8.0 — Incremental rebuilds

The Quillstack site generator now rebuilds only pages affected by a content change instead of the full tree. New hires: this means staging deploys take seconds, not minutes, but stale-page bugs are now possible — if you see outdated content, force a full rebuild before filing anything. Dependency graph lives in the build manifest. Questions about the rebuild logic go to the maintainer listed below.

named custodian: Oliath Ralax

Subject: DR drill follow-up — websocket reconnect defect

Hi — during Thursday's disaster-recovery drill for the Lanternfold gateway, we reproduced the reconnect bug: clients re-established sockets without re-presenting session proof, briefly trusting stale tokens. The fix forces full re-auth on reconnect. For your review, the drill's recovery console remains sealed; to replay the captured session, authenticate to the drill vault with the passphrase noted immediately below.

recovery phrase for bawep-kawef: oliath-casdor

09:41 — Matchwell pairing latency spiked; GC pauses on the Orbex matcher hit 4s. 09:50 — Heap dump captured; promotion storm from candidate cache. 10:05 — Cache TTL halved, pauses back under 200ms. Permanent fix lands in the next release train; the affected artifact is identified below.

pipeline stamp: htk9_6ce9d33c5

Hey Priya — handing off the Quillbill PDF invoice renderer before I'm out next week. Rendering is stable since the Mirelight 2.4 font fix; the only flaky bit is the footer pagination on multi-currency invoices, which Tomas is tracking. Release checklist is in the usual folder. Staging and prod both run the same build now, so no surprises there. For the cut, these are the config values the renderer currently runs with:

settings of fafog-haduf:
ZORIX_PIN=4648
ZORIX_METRICS_HOST=metrics.zorix.paliqsys.corp
ZORIX_LOG_LEVEL=info
ZORIX_TENANT=druix